Meaning and Usage

"手套" refers to gloves, which are coverings for the hands used for protection, warmth, or hygiene. It is a common noun used in everyday contexts such as clothing, medical settings, and sports.

医生在手术时会戴无菌手套,保证手部清洁。

Yīshēng zài shǒushù shí huì dài wújūn shǒutào, bǎozhèng shǒubù qīngjié.

Doctors wear sterile gloves during surgery to ensure hand cleanliness.

他买了一副皮手套,准备骑摩托车用。

Tā mǎile yī fù pí shǒutào, zhǔnbèi qí mótuōchē yòng.

He bought a pair of leather gloves to use while riding a motorcycle.
